Blueberry Pancakes
Recipe from About.com Southern Food
Ingredients:
2 cups of flour sifted before using
21/2 tsp of baking powder
3 Tablespoons of sugar
1/2 tsp. salt
2 large eggs
11/2 cups of milk
2 Tablespoons of melted butter
1 to 11/2 cups of blueberries washed
Directions:
Sift together flour, baking powder, sugar and salt. In a separate bowl whisk together the milk and the eggs, then add to the flour mixture, stir until smooth. Blend in the melted butter. If the mixture seems too think add a little more milk to reach the desired consistency. Add the blueberries and stir lightly so as not to break the fruit.
Cook the pancakes on a lightly greased griddle. Pour 1/4 cup of batter on griddle and cook until little bubbles appear on the surface and the edges are slightly browned, then flip and brown the other side.
Serve with butter and syrup.
